The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) has introduced two new surveys, the 'Inflation Expectations Survey of Households' and the 'Consumer Confidence Survey,' aimed at providing crucial insights for the upcoming bi-monthly monetary policy. Scheduled for June 5-7, 2024, the next policy review will benefit from these surveys.The 'Inflation Expectations Survey of Households' will gather subjective evaluations on price movements and inflation based on individual consumption patterns. This survey spans 19 cities, including Guwahati, Hyderabad, Jaipur, Kolkata, Lucknow, and Thiruvananthapuram, as outlined by the RBI in a recent release.This survey will gather qualitative responses from households regarding price changes, including general prices and specific product groups, over the next three months and one year. Additionally, it will collect quantitative data on current, three-month ahead, and one-year ahead inflation rates.
